Selecting an Agent
Homeowners are advised to select a local agent familiar with the area in
which the home is located. A local agent will be knowledgeable of local market
conditions and how this may affect pricing. An experienced agent will be able to
conduct a current market analysis to help homeowners better understand the state
of the real estate market and what it means to them. A real estate agent will
develop a personalized marketing plan or strategy based on the property and the
property's potential buyers. Homeowners should discuss with the real estate
agent their ideas for making the property more attractive to potential buyers.
Agents can advise them on improvements that will enhance the value and aesthetic

Determining the Property's Sale Price
Real estate agents will use a systematic approach to determining the market
value of the home. Using information such as prices of homes that have recently
sold, prices of homes currently for sale, and buyer's expectations, real estate
agents can set home prices at levels appropriate for market conditions.
Homeowners should be more concerned with getting the best price for their
property rather than trying to determine how much they can get for their home.
This will be a crucial question that they will want to address with their agent.
Based on the market, the best price for the property may not always be what is
